So the Filthy Dukes full length just arrived over here at the tuftsmania batcave. It makes me want to do pushups.
It’s called “Nonsense in the Dark” and it’s truly, honestly no-frills, no-nonsense electronic pop music. Filthy Dukes pulled all the right influences out of their memory banks and put together a collection of really catchy music. vibrating synths, screaming electric strings, they even emulate a bit of the ’soulwax’ noise. (you know what I’m talking about… that SSCCCCRReeeeeEEEEEeeee synth that sounds so bad but feels so right)
